#301b10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#301b10 is composed of 18.8% red, 10.6%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.8%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 81.2% black. It has a hue angle of 20.6 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 12.5%. #301b10 color hex could be obtained by blending #603620 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#301b10 color description : Very dark (mostly black) orange [Brown tone].
#301b10 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#301b10 has RGB values of R:48, G:27,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.67, K:0.81. Its decimal value is 3152656.
